#b651b9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b651b9 is composed of 71.4% red, 31.8%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.6% cyan, 56.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 298.3 degrees, a saturation of 42.6% and a lightness of 52.2%. #b651b9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a2ff with #6d0073.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#b651b9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080308 is the darkest color, while #fcf9fd is the lightest one.
